Albendazole Oral Suspension 2.5 A Comprehensive Overview


Albendazole is a broad-spectrum anthelmintic agent that has been widely used in the treatment of various parasitic infections. Among its formulations, the oral suspension form at a concentration of 2.5% is particularly significant, especially for pediatric use and patients who may have difficulty swallowing tablets. This article aims to provide a detailed overview of albendazole oral suspension 2.5, encompassing its mechanism of action, therapeutic uses, dosage guidelines, side effects, and precautions.


Mechanism of Action


Albendazole belongs to the benzimidazole class of drugs and works by inhibiting the polymerization of tubulin, which is crucial for the formation of microtubules in helminths (worms). This action disrupts vital cellular processes such as glucose uptake, resulting in the depletion of glycogen stores in the parasites and ultimately leading to their death. Due to its ability to act on a wide variety of helminths, albendazole has become a cornerstone in antiparasitic therapy.


Therapeutic Uses


Albendazole oral suspension 2.5% is indicated for the treatment of several intestinal and systemic parasitic infections. These include


1. Ascariasis This common soil-transmitted helminth infection affects millions worldwide, especially in areas with poor sanitation. 2. Hookworm Infections Albendazole is effective against Ancylostoma duodenale and Necator americanus, the two species of hookworms that afflict humans. 3. Trichuriasis The drug also targets Trichuris trichiura, the whipworm, which can cause gastrointestinal symptoms and anemia. 4. Echinococcosis In cases of cystic echinococcosis (hydrated cyst disease) caused by Echinococcus granulosus, albendazole can be used as an adjunct to surgery. 5. Neurocysticercosis For cysticercus infections in the central nervous system, albendazole plays a critical role in treatment, often in combination with corticosteroids.


Dosage Guidelines


The dosage of albendazole oral suspension 2.5% varies based on the type of infection and the age of the patient


- Children The standard dose for most infections is 10-15 mg/kg/day, administered in divided doses, typically not to exceed 400 mg per day. - Adults The usual recommended dose is also 400 mg per day, administered as a single dose for most intestinal helminth infections or in divided doses for systemic infections.


The suspension formulation is particularly beneficial for children or individuals with swallowing difficulties, providing a palatable option that can be easily administered.

Side Effects


While generally well-tolerated, albendazole can cause side effects in some individuals. Common side effects include


- Nausea and vomiting - Stomach pain - Loss of appetite - Headache - Dizziness


Severe side effects are rare but can occur, especially with prolonged use. These may include liver function abnormalities, allergic reactions, and bone marrow suppression. It is crucial to monitor liver enzymes and blood cell counts during long-term treatment.


Precautions


Before prescribing albendazole oral suspension 2.5%, healthcare professionals should evaluate the patient’s medical history. Contraindications include


- Pregnancy Albendazole has been classified as Category C for pregnant women due to potential teratogenic effects, especially in the first trimester. - Liver Disease Patients with compromised liver function should use this medication cautiously due to the risk of increased toxicity.


Additionally, it is essential to ensure that patients are well-informed about the importance of completing the entire prescribed course of treatment to prevent reinfection.
